Number sequences worksheets for Grade 8 students available through Wayground (formerly Quizizz) provide comprehensive practice with identifying, extending, and analyzing mathematical patterns that form the foundation of algebraic thinking. These carefully designed worksheets strengthen critical skills including recognizing arithmetic and geometric progressions, determining nth terms, finding missing terms in sequences, and understanding the relationships between consecutive terms. Students work through practice problems that challenge them to identify patterns in number sequences, calculate common differences and ratios, and apply sequence formulas to solve real-world applications. Each worksheet comes with a detailed answer key and is available as a free printable pdf, making it easy for educators to incorporate sequence practice into their mathematics instruction while providing students with immediate feedback on their problem-solving strategies.
